drdiana2010 said:hehe, well here are more specific tuition numbers over 4 years
(allows 4% annual increase for inflation)
FSU:
First Year-$18,273.41
Second Year-$19,004.34
Third Year- $19,764.52
Fourth Year- $20,555.10
Total Cost=$77,597.37 tuition (estimated)
UM:
First Year- 31,009.48
Second Year-$32,249.86
Third Year-$33,539.85
Fourth Year-$34,881.44
Total Cost=$131,680.63 tuition (estimated)
